Archivo del Autor: Liarjo

Avatar de Desconocido

Acerca de Liarjo

....

Cafeina.cl: Software Factory cómo lograr la mayor productividad

El jueves 8 de MArzo , Luis Hereira va a dar una exclente conferencia técnica en MSDN.

Software Factory cómo lograr la mayor productividad

La productividad es un tema preocupante para todas las empresas que desarrollan software. Una diferencia notable con el resto de los actores del mercado puede ser la clave del éxito en un mundo regido por las leyes de Darwin, donde la evolución es una constante necesidad. Solo los más fuertes sobreviven. Hacer de tú empresa una verdadera fábrica de producción plantea desafíos importantes, donde la herramienta, metodología, formalización del conocimiento y ordenamiento de los equipos de desarrollo son las claves del éxito. Las ”Fábricas de Software” intentan hoy día dar solución a estos temas. Durante la conferencia estaremos haciendo un recorrido por la iniciativa “Software Factory” de Microsoft, cuales son sus ventajas, como usarlos, que tenemos a nuestro alcance y como hacer los nuestros.

Orador:
Luis A. Hereira Aguilera

Pueden registrarse en el siguiente Link:

http://msevents.microsoft.com/CUI/EventDetail.aspx?EventID=1032330799&Culture=es-CL

Nos vemos ahí.

Guidance Automation Toolkit (GAT)

Hola,

GAT está orientado a simplificar la generación de código reusable entre aplicaciones y dejarlos disponibles directamente en Visual Studio 2005.

Mediante la generación de código se mejora la performance del equipo al entregarle directamente en la herramienta de desarrollo plantillas dinámicas de generación de código.

Desde el punto de vista del arquitecto (líder técnico) apoya a mantener código homogéneo y normalizado en los proyectos, reduciendo la complejidad de la estructuración de las jerarquitas de clases y la distribución de las clases en diferentes binarios.

Los siguientes Links dan un paseo por la información disponible de GAT:

Serie de Conferencias Técnicas: WCF en MSDN, Primera Conferencia

Titulo  Conferencia I

Serie conferencias técnicas WCF: Introducción y mejores prácticas de WCF.

Descripción conferencia I

Esta primera sesión está orientada a arquitectos y desarrollador que estén interesados en conocer la nueva plataforma WCF. WCF conocida anteriormente como indigo, es la nueva plataforma de comunicación que se incorpora con el framework dotnet  3.0 (WinFX).

WCF es la plataforma que viene a unificar todas las técnicas de comunicaciones que se usan en la plataforma Microsoft en un solo modelo de programación. Si usted  es desarrollador de Web Services / MSMQ/ COM+/ REmoting / etc… tiene que conocer WCF porque le dará nuevas posibilidades de comunicaciones para sus sistemas.

Pronto más información de la segunda y tercera conferencia.

Viviendo la vida Google

Viendo la vida Google, leí esto en la mañana mientras tomaba un café.

Si expresar si las soluciones Google son buenas o malas, eso es para otro POST, el hacer reportajes publicitarios es un tema cuestionable. Yo los llamo PubliReportajes.

Si quieren un ejemplo pueden ver este, que pareció en el diario el mercurio el día de hoy.

Enjoy.

Viviendo la vida google, EL mercurio.

PD: ¿Quiene es Andrés Zúñiga?

🙂

Serie de Conferencias Técnicas: WCF en MSDN, Tópicos incluidos

Para esta serie de conferencias, ya hay un primer borrador de temas a tocar en las conferencias ténicas.

Los tópicos serían:

1. Endpoints: Addresses, Bindings, and Contracts

2. Data Transfer and Serialization

3. Sessions, Instancing, and Concurrency

4. Transports in WCF

5. Queues and Reliable Sessions

6. Transactions

7. Windows Communication Foundation Security

8. Peer to Peer Networking

9. Metadata

10. Clients

11. Hosting

12. Interoperability and Integration

No tengo claro que calificar de avanzado y que de intermedio, pero por lo menos está la cobertura de los tópicos de la conferencia.

🙂

Technight: SOA Evaluación natural de las soluciones de integración

Los cambios en el mundo de los negocios de hoy imponen nuevos desafíos a los equipos de IT. Las nuevas estrategias de negocio, la automatización de procesos fuerzan a las organizaciones a integrar sus diferentes tecnologías con la misma eficiencia. La aproximación tradicional ha sido la integración punto a punto, en la práctica esto es el sistema de comunicación directa entre dos sistemas usando un protocolo e interfaces propietarios. Está técnica es muy efectiva en el corto plazo pero tienen altos costos de mantención y operación.

SOA es una alternativa mucho más robusta, que provee una integración administrada y una mejor arquitectura, que da como resultado una mejor confiabilidad, facilidad para soportar cambios y bajos costos de integración. En está presentación exploraremos las alternativas que tenemos para enfrentar este nuevo paradigma y desarrollaremos la tesis que SOA es la evolución natural para resolver los problemas cada vez complejos de integración.

Oradores:
Wilson Pais: Gerente de Socios Desarrolladores & Académicos – Microsoft Cono Sur
Juan Pablo Garcia: Software Developer Manager- Datco Chile

viernes, 23 de febrero de 2007 18:30 – viernes, 23 de febrero de 2007 21:30 Santiago
Hora de recepción: 18:30

Microsoft Chile

Mariano Sanchez Fontecilla 310, Piso 6
Las Condes Región Metropolitana Chile

El link de registro es Registro TechNight

PROPUESTA DE PROYECTO FINAL Para optar al grado de Magíster en Tecnologías de la Información

I.                  RESUMEN

 

El trabajo propuesto tiene como objetivo definir una práctica de consultoría para la gerencia de servicios profesionales de Datco Chile. Está práctica debe permitir ayudar a los  clientes a identificar en que punto se encuentran cuando deciden iniciar proyectos de desarrollo de una arquitectura orientada a servicios SOA.  

En la actualidad, este servicio se ha realizado por lo menos en tres clientes grandes del mercado local. En los tres casos se han hecho actividades, generado artefactos y entregado resultados diferentes a los clientes por no tener definido de buena manera el servicio de SOA Assessment.

 La idea es que está práctica de consultoría sea un análisis de los principales procesos de negocio y motivaciones de la arquitectura empresarial que de como resultado un conjunto de recomendaciones y una hoja de ruta para adoptar SOA. Entre las principales áreas del cliente a ser analizadas se encuentran: arquitectura, estrategia de la organización, perfiles, procesos y prácticas, así como herramientas y tecnología.

La metodología a seguir es investigar las diferentes ofertas que los proveedores de tecnología base como Microsoft, Oracle, BEA, SUN, etc. tienen para enfrentar el problema del Assessment de SOA. Luego, diseñar una evaluación que este de acuerdo a la realidad de las empresas grandes del mercado local. Este instrumento es el que se usuario como diagnostico inicial y según el resultado que el cliente obtiene se define cuales son las actividades consultivas que se necesitan para logar escribir la hoja de ruta de ese cliente en particular hacia una arquitectura orientada a Servicios.

El resultado esperado de este trabajo es tener una descripción de la práctica de consultoría, un instrumento de evaluación inicial del cliente y un proceso de generación de la hoja de ruta que sea variable según el resultado del diagnostico inicial del cliente.

Adopting and Benefiting from Agile Processes in Offshore Software Development

En el negocio de desarrollo de software siempre se busca ser más competitivo. Existen dos tendencias para ello: el desarrollo ágil de software y la construcción en centros de desarrollo (Fabricas de software).

En este artículo se hace un recorrido transversal de las buenas prácticas para adoptar ambas técnicas de manera coordinada para obtener mejores resultados.

Link to Adopting and Benefiting from Agile Processes in Offshore Software Development